The Rainflower M043.207.11.011.00, seen from the bench

The Mido Rainflower reference M043.207.11.011.00 is equipped with the automatic caliber ETA C07.611 with hour, minute, second and date indication. The watch features 15mm lugs and represents the contemporary interpretation of the Swiss brand in the ladies' automatic watch segment. The movement ensures essential functions with the typical robustness of the ETA C07 series calibers.

What is the lug width of the Mido Rainflower M043.207.11.011.00?

The lug width (misura ansa) of the Mido Rainflower M043.207.11.011.00 is exactly 15mm. This dimension, below the common standards of 16-18mm, is characteristic of watches designed for slender wrists and requires straps specifically manufactured for this width. To verify it yourself, measure the distance between the two horizontal pins where the strap attaches: the value must be precisely 15mm.

What is the best strap for the Mido Rainflower?

The ideal strap for the Rainflower depends on your intended use. For formal elegance, an alligator leather in brown or black with irregular grain imparts understated sophistication. For everyday wear, smooth calf leather in medium tones (brown, cognac) offers versatility without compromise. For sport-casual contexts, a NATO strap in navy or dark grey preserves the elegant character without excessive formality. All options must strictly respect the 15mm width specification.

How do you change the strap on the Mido Rainflower M043.207.11.011.00?

Changing the strap requires no specialised skills. Use a spring bar removal tool or a blunt, thin object (such as a pencil tip). Insert the tool horizontally beneath the spring mechanism of the lateral pin, press gently downward to release the pin, then extract the old strap. Repeat on the opposite side. Insert the new strap by aligning the lateral holes with the pins, ensuring the strap width is exactly 15mm. The spring tension must snap firmly into place when the pin is correctly seated.

Which aftermarket straps are compatible with the 15mm Rainflower?

Aftermarket straps compatible with the Mido Rainflower M043.207.11.011.00 must have a lug width of exactly 15mm. They are available in numerous materials: alligator, calf, suede, vegetable-tanned leather, aged leather, NATO nylon, textured rubber. Specialist artisans produce custom straps with integrated deployante clasp systems, enhancing wearing comfort. Always verify the declared width is 15mm and not 16mm, as a 1mm error compromises the fit within the case lugs.

How long does a leather strap last on the Mido Rainflower?

Leather strap longevity depends on material type and usage frequency. High-quality alligator, worn regularly but not daily, lasts 4-6 years before replacement becomes necessary, developing a desirable patina throughout. Smooth calf has comparable lifespan, approximately 4-5 years under normal conditions. Vegetable-tanned leather, naturally more resilient under stress, may reach 6-8 years of service. NATO nylon straps offer similar durability, around 5 years. Rubber straps typically last 3-4 years before elasticity diminishes. Environmental factors—humidity, sunlight exposure, wear frequency, and maintenance—significantly influence longevity. Storing the strap in a dry environment and occasional cleaning with a soft, slightly dampened cloth extends its useful life considerably.
